Output 90ead6ed4580b7a9aa653b49568d7b65dc41ac2fbfc91fa6e766274178a0f997:0

value
29592855
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1baa8cbba792ad7fffc00512a9fbff742d57a19c OP_EQUAL
address
34DJUj71pjwPoEURs1prWzr4KqH2SBaqay
transaction
90ead6ed4580b7a9aa653b49568d7b65dc41ac2fbfc91fa6e766274178a0f997
spent
true